SB302,25,223 157.62 (5) Rules; records. (intro.) The department cemetery board may shall
24promulgate rules requiring cemetery authorities and licensees to maintain other
25records and establishing minimum time periods for the maintenance of those

1records. The records shall include detailed information for each deceased person
2buried in a cemetery, including all of the following:
SB302,69 3Section 69. 157.62 (5) (a) to (j) of the statutes are created to read:
SB302,25,44 157.62 (5) (a) The name of the deceased.
SB302,25,55 (b) The last-known address of the deceased.
SB302,25,66 (c) The date of birth of the deceased.
SB302,25,77 (d) The date of death.
SB302,25,88 (e) The date of burial.
SB302,25,99 (f) The exact location in the cemetery where the deceased is buried.
SB302,25,1110 (g) The name of the person authorizing the burial and his or her relationship
11to the deceased.
SB302,25,1212 (h) The name of the funeral establishment, as defined in s. 445.01 (6).
SB302,25,1313 (i) The type of burial vault used, if any.
SB302,25,1414 (j) The type and style of the grave marker, monument, or other memorial used.

SB302,25,2316 157.62 (6) Audit. Except as provided in ss. 157.625, 157.63 (5), and 440.92 (9)
17(e), the department cemetery board may audit, at reasonable times and frequency,
18the records, trust funds, and accounts of any cemetery authority, including records,
19trust funds, and accounts pertaining to services provided by a cemetery authority
20which that are not otherwise subject to the requirements under this chapter. The
21department cemetery board may conduct audits under this subsection on a random
22basis, and shall conduct all audits under this subsection without providing prior
23notice to the cemetery authority.
